Residential Real Estate Outlook

According to a comprehensive report titled “Indian Real Estate: Taking Giant Strides 2023 Mid Year Outlook” by CBRE, a prominent real estate consultancy, both residential sales and new launches are on the verge of reaching a ten-year high in 2023. The report predicts that the number of units sold and launched could potentially touch, or even surpass, the remarkable milestone of 300,000 units.

Emerging Market Segments

The mid-end category of residential real estate has transcended the 1 crore mark, indicating strong demand, particularly in the ‘sweet spot’ of the 1 – 1.5 crore price range. Additionally, the premium and luxury segments are also emerging as sought-after investment avenues, especially among High Net Worth Individuals (HNIs) and Non-Resident Indians (NRIs).

Green-Certified Office Spaces

Shifting our focus to the commercial real estate sector, the CBRE-CII joint report, presented at the CII Realty 2023 conference, reveals a growing emphasis on sustainability. Green-certified office spaces in India have witnessed a remarkable 36% increase since 2019, now accounting for approximately 342 million square feet across the top six cities.

Leading the Green Revolution

Among these cities, Bangalore, Delhi-NCR, and Mumbai stand as pioneers, commanding a cumulative share of 68% of the total green-certified office stock in India as of June 2023. The report also highlights substantial growth in certified green office stock, boasting a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.1% over the past five years.

Bangalore Leads the Charge

Bangalore takes the lead among all Indian cities in terms of green-compliant office stock, representing 30% of the total pan-India stock. Following closely, Delhi-NCR holds 21%, while Mumbai accounts for 17% of the certified office stock in India as of June 2023.

Office Leasing Activity

The report also highlights that leasing activity across real estate assets remained robust during January-June 2023 and is poised for further growth in the July-December 2023 period. Notably, office leasing activity reached approximately 26.4 million square feet during the first half of 2023, with Bangalore, Chennai, and Delhi-NCR accounting for 60% of the overall leasing.

REITs Market Expansion

The report sheds light on the expansion of the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) market in India. With the listing of India’s first retail REIT in 2023, the market is expected to diversify further. Furthermore, the listing of India’s fourth office sector REIT is on the horizon.

Data Centers on the Rise

By the end of 2023, India’s total data center capacity is projected to increase by about 35% annually, reaching a substantial 1,048 megawatts. A planned supply of approximately 170 megawatts in the second half of the year further underscores the growth potential in this sector.
